Essential Duties & Responsibilities

  • Routinely communicates with the Telecom System Manager and others as appropriate, regarding department functions and the status of various programs, services, and financial objectives.
  • Work to maintain Telecom Department SLA timelines for call backs, installations, and problem resolutions.
  • Responsible for accurate ticket reporting.
  • Participates as a technical member of the Telecommunications work team, assisting with technical installations as required, as well as with planning and operational management.
  • Also, monitors daily work requests in tracking systems and completes requests for system configurations.
  • Primary responsibility is for the proper configuration of the phone system. Telecom Analysts are expected to be able to configure call forwarding, call routing, voice menus, and call recordings. Ability to program ACD agents and skills.
  • Oversees and meets with end users to design solutions for their workflow requirements.
  • Mentors entry level Telecom Associates.
  • Manages telecom projects and supervises the work of Telecom Associates and Contractors working for the Telecommunications Department to ensure quality of craftsmanship or to verify and approve the installation of new services and equipment.
  • Requests assistance from the Telecom Architect for difficult or complex work requests or projects.
  • Will be required to manage small projects and must be able to work independently or collaboratively in multidisciplinary groups (construction projects, move projects, complex installations, etc).
  • Facilitates the resolution of alarms/outages within the Telecommunications Systems by implementing advanced debugging processes, including consulting with vendors, initiating internal testing procedures, running reports as directed by management or coordinating the delivery of parts to specified locations either in person or by courier.
  • Responsible for maintaining critical communications services in emergency situations and must be available off hours for major installations, upgrades, outages, and on-call rotation.
